> The TR-3 manual was silent on the issue in
> the section
> describing the hub assembly but when I turned to the lubrication
> section the
> manual recommended 5 strokes of a grease gun every 5000 miles.

I believe that applied only to very early TR2, which reportedly had grease
zerks on the front hubs (although some have expressed doubt that they were,
in fact, ever delivered with the zerks installed).

> The TR-6
> is the only one that doesn't, on the surface, make sense. The
> TR-6 hubs don't
> have grease nipples and they want you to "Partially pack the hub
> with grease."
> I can only ask why? Opinions????

I've always thought it was a mistranslation or mistake somewhere along the
line.  Note that the hubs are identical from late TR3 (with disc brakes)
until TR6.  The TR4 factory workshop manual contains the line "Pack the
rollers and hubs with grease, working it well into the rollers", which seems
to imply the hub should be fully packed with grease.  I can only surmise
that someone meant only to smear some grease onto the outer races in the
hub.

In any case, I've always greased my TR3A "normally", ie no grease in the hub
at all, only a generous amount hand-packed into the bearings.  I think I've
changed front wheel bearings once in 20 years, and they probably didn't need
it then ...
